ISLAMABAD: The Federal Board of Revenue (FBR) has assigned revenue collection target of Rs 207 billion for August 2016.
Sources told Customs Today that FBR Member Inland Revenue Operation Dr Mohammad Irshad has already issued necessary instructions in this regard. It is necessary to mention here that the FBR is quite optimistic about achieving the assigned target in due course of time. Sources said that the FBR has also directed all Large Taxpayers Units (LTUs) and Regional Tax Offices (RTOs) to submit their revenue collection reports daily.
FBR already made it clear that any negligence in achieving revenue collection target will not entertained and those RTOs and LTUs who will not achieve revenue collection target will have to explain the reasons behind their failure. FBR Member Dr. Mohammad Irshad himself is monitoring the revenue collection measures on daily basis and is contact with all chief commissioners in this regard.
